Now you can eat the candied peels as is, … Unlike the inner fruit of an orange, the peel has a tough, dry texture that is difficult to chew. It’s also bitter, which some people may find off-putting. Despite its nutritional benefits, the combination of a bitter flavorand tough texture may make orange peels unappealing. See more Pesticides are frequently used on citrus fruits like oranges to protect against mold and insects (13Trusted Source). Though studies have found … See more Due to their tough texture and high fiber content, orange peels can be difficult to digest. Eating them, especially larger pieces at a time, could cause stomach discomfort, such as cramps or bloating.
